Hello Florian
Tank you! I bought the front and rear bumper from this guy on eBay: I got the front hood and the fenders from a guy in Sweden (no website) and I think he is out of business now. I do believe the guy on eBay have them also. My rear fenders are steel. I drive original Fuchs 8x15 and 9x15. Finding tyres can be hard and expensive! Michelin TB5 and Pirelli Corsa Classic are probably the right thing but they are very, very expensive. As I do a lot of track days i opted for Bridgestone Potenza RE55 in the front in 225/50-15 and Toyo R888 in the rear in 235/50-15. When measurering the Toyos the are actually more like 255-260! /Christian Quote:
